The secret to this Italian-style pie is that the apple slices on top are lightly drizzled with melted butter and sprinkled with sugar. This creates a delicious crust that significantly enhances the dessert's flavor. Intrigued? Then gather your ingredients and get started with me!

Apple4 pcs
-
Egg C11 pcs
-
Egg yolk1 pcs
-
Sugar150 G
-
Flour160 G
-
Milk120 ml
-
Butter50 G
-
Baking powder1 tsp
-
Vanillin1 pinch
-
Salt1 pinch
Mix the egg with the yolk, sugar, salt, and vanilla. Beat well until the mixture is white and fluffy.
Add 25 g of melted butter and milk to the egg-sugar mixture. Stir. The butter is necessary for a softer dough.
Add sifted flour and baking powder to the mixture and knead the dough. Its consistency should resemble that of heavy cream.
Line the bottom of a baking pan with parchment paper. Pour the batter into the pan and smooth it out.
Wash the apples, core them, and cut them into small slices.
Place the sliced apples tightly next to each other on top of the dough.
Drizzle the pie with melted butter and sprinkle with a tablespoon of sugar. This will create a beautiful and delicious caramel crust.
Bake the pie in a preheated oven at 180°C for 30-35 minutes. Then remove it, let it cool slightly, and dust with powdered sugar.

- Two easy ways to melt butter are to microwave it for a few seconds or use a double boiler;
- To make sure the treat comes off the sides of the pan easily, grease it with butter and sprinkle a little flour on top;
- To ensure an airy batter, it's important to beat the eggs thoroughly. If they're not beaten enough, the finished dessert may turn out flat.
- It's important to preheat the oven to the required temperature. This will allow the charlotte to rise well during cooking.
- To prevent the pie from falling after baking, let it cool in the oven for 10 minutes before removing it.
